## Runbook: Sketchloom 4.2 — undo/redo overhaul

Heads up for the sync: this release swaps the old command stack for the new branching history model. Undo/redo should feel identical to users, but the serialized format changed, so diagrams saved in 4.2 won't open in 4.1. We've got a migration shim for the Fernbay cohort. Roll out canary first, watch the history-corruption metric for an hour, then go wide. Canary artifacts must be verified against the deploy key, which is the following.

signing key of bagap-yawep = bky13_TbfT6ZMUoGJo2

**Q: Are the lifts running this weekend?** No. Both lifts in the Halloway Annexe are down for winch maintenance Saturday 06:00 to Sunday 18:00. Direct staff to the east stairwell. Goods deliveries should be deferred or rerouted via the Penfold loading dock. Contractors from Bray Vertical Systems will be on site; they sign in at the facilities desk as normal. The stairwell door locks after 19:00, so anyone working late will need the weekend access code. Issue it only to rostered staff. The code is below.

badge for bawef-bahap: bdg-LALUM-4

## Ownership

The clock-skew monitor for the Quarrylight build farm lives in this repo. Build agents occasionally drift more than the 250ms tolerance, which breaks artifact timestamp ordering and causes the Slatebird scheduler to mark runs as flaky. If support sees skew alerts, first check the NTP sidecar logs, then escalate rather than restarting agents manually — restarts mask the drift without fixing it. Questions about the monitor, its thresholds, or the escalation path go to the component owner listed below.

account owner for kagag-yahap: Novath Quenok